Regrettable Fan-on-Field Moments

Laura DeptaMay 13, 2015

There are a shocking number of regrettable moments involving sports fans on the field of play. Today, let's focus on the worst in recent memory.

Now, who knows if the Old Dominion streaker regrets his actions? He certainly should. Disrupting the game, assaulting a player, scaling a catch fence—these are all actions unworthy of praise.

The following fans, at minimum, looked foolish. At worst, they were viciously tackled or even prosecuted. Whose #streakfails were worst? Let's find out.

Honorable Mention: Somersault Guy

This one gets an honorable mention because it's really more hilarious than regrettable. During a recent baseball game in St. Louis, one fan somehow sprinted all the way through the outfield before diving on home plate to successfully complete a somersault. 

Honorable Mention: Rogue Diver

Streaking at a diving competition—that's not something you see every day. However, this incident is an honorable mention because it, too, seems more awesome than regrettable. The streaker at the Diving World Series even takes a bow at the end. Watch and enjoy.

Selfie Streaker

Some fans will do anything for a selfie, including streaking across a soccer field in their skivvies. This guy's mission went off almost without a hitch until he tripped and fell toward the end. Sad.

Pierogi Race Guy

During a 2014 game at Pittsburgh's PNC Park, one fan made it onto the field and joined the Great Pierogi Race that happens between innings. Shirtless and unafraid, the man almost made it over the right field wall to safety, but alas, it was not to be.

Two Dudes in Detroit

Who in their right mind would run onto an NFL field of play with, you know, actual players on the field?

You may recall in November, the Buffalo Bills and New York Jets played a football game in Detroit due to a whole mess of snow. During the relocated game, not one, but two fans sprinted across the field before security stopped them. One even tried to approach the players. He lived, surprisingly.

World Cup Final Guy

A streaker invaded the pitch at the World Cup final and actually tried to kiss Benedikt Howedes of Germany. He eventually suffered a pretty rough takedown at the hands of security. Luckily, LeBron James was there to capture the moment in all its disgraceful glory.

Wrigley Rain Delay

This fan decided to run onto Wrigley Field during a rain delay in 2014. He wasn't hurting anyone. In fact, the most regrettable thing here is this brave soul didn't get a chance to do a Slip'N Slide on the tarp.

Naked Spiker

At a 2014 Old Dominion football game, not only did one man streak onto the field in the buff, but he Gronked a football while he was at it.

It was sort of great until he was eventually tackled and later charged with indecent exposure.

NASCAR Fence Climber

So you're not supposed to climb the catch fence at NASCAR races—no, not even to take a selfie. The 2014 NASCAR Sprint Cup race at Richmond had to move to yellow while one fan learned this lesson.

Sore Loser

No one likes a sore loser. One fan didn't take too kindly to his Hamburg team losing to Bayern Munich recently, 3-1. Bayern's Franck Ribery scored near the end of the game, and the fan took it out on him personally—on the field.

Rugby Brawler

During a 2014 rugby match between Newcastle and Northumbria University, this guy streaked fully nude across the pitch. Not only that, but he tackled one of the players, inciting an all-out brawl.

Who knows if this person regretted his actions personally, but regardless, his reckless stunt was completely out of line and disrespectful to the game.

Kick to the Face

Who knows what expectations exist in the minds of fans who charge fields? Just a guess, but they probably don't include taking a ninja kick to the face.

After a match between Club Deportivo Marathon and Real Espana, unhappy Marathon fans invaded the pitch in what turned out to be a very regrettable display of violence overall. A Real Espana player kicked one unlucky fan in the face, according to Ian McCourt of the Guardian.

Criminal Trespassing

An Ohio State football coach leveled Anthony Wunder, and Wunder almost lost his scholarship. All of this was because of one ill-advised fan-on-field incident (Wunder being the fan in question, of course). Sure, he became a bit of an Internet sensation, but almost losing a scholarship and pleading guilty to a misdemeanor? Not worth it.

Rugby Streaker Leveled

Of all the playing surfaces to invade, a Rugby pitch seems like the farthest thing from a safe option. Rugby players don't seem as hesitant to get involved with the capture as, say, baseball players.

Exhibit A: Chris Hala'ufia of London Welsh laid the smackdown on a streaking fan during a recent match against Leicester.
